Focusing on the evolution of archaeological education, this volume chronicles the British School at Athens from its inception in 1886, highlighting its shift towards scientific archaeology and major projects like the Cyprus Exploration Fund and excavations in Crete and Laconia. It details the impact of its students, many of whom contributed to archaeological work across the Levant, Egypt, and beyond. Additionally, the book includes comprehensive indexes listing students by various categories, enhancing the understanding of the institution's educational influence.
